MAN TGL — the number before the dot is weight, after it power
A MAN TGL 12.250 is rated at 12 tonnes and delivers 250 hp. A 7.150 means 7.5 tonnes and 150 hp; a 12.180 carries the same 12 tonnes with 180 hp. The system is consistent: gross vehicle weight before the dot, engine output after it. Comparing two TGLs, you can see at a glance whether you are looking at the same vehicle with a different engine or at another weight class.

The TGL is MAN's light range: distribution work in cities and regions, plus lighter construction duty. Together with the larger TGM it covers roughly 7.5 to 26 tonnes. The engines come from the D08 family; the four-cylinder units displace 4.58 litres and produce 150 to 220 hp depending on version.
The series has a long production run behind it. The 12.180 was built from 2005 to 2017; the 12.250 is a more recent version. For the used market that means the same type designation can cover vehicles spanning more than a decade — emissions stage and equipment differ accordingly.
When comparing two offers it is therefore worth looking less at the type number than at the year and emissions standard. The number tells you how heavy and how strong; it says nothing about which generation stands before you.

What to check before buying
- Check the hour meter against the service records — a replaced instrument is the most common gap.
- Compare the data plate and chassis number with the papers.
- Check the weights in the papers against the figures here — attachments change them.
- Ask about parts availability for this build year — the running costs hang on it.
A general list for this type of machine — no substitute for an inspection or an appraiser.
